- What is ADMA Biologics's taxes paid on vested restricted stock units?
- ADMA Biologics (ADMA) reported taxes paid on vested restricted stock units of $5.06M in Q1 2026.
- How has ADMA Biologics's taxes paid on vested restricted stock units changed year-over-year?
- ADMA Biologics's taxes paid on vested restricted stock units decreased by 30.0% year-over-year, from $7.23M to $5.06M.
- What is the long-term trend for ADMA Biologics's taxes paid on vested restricted stock units?
-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), ADMA Biologics's taxes paid on vested restricted stock units has grown at a 252.3%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$62K to $9.55M.
- What does taxes paid on vested restricted stock units mean?
- The cash outflow associated with the company's payment of tax obligations on behalf of employees when restricted stock units vest. This is a common feature of equity compensation plans and represents a recurring financing-related cash requirement.
